]> git.apps.os.sepia.ceph.com Git - ceph-ci.git/commitdiff
messages: Update MAuthReply.h to work without using namespace
authorAdam C. Emerson <aemerson@redhat.com>
Fri, 29 Mar 2019 00:55:06 +0000 (20:55 -0400)
committerAdam C. Emerson <aemerson@redhat.com>
Fri, 29 Mar 2019 14:30:36 +0000 (10:30 -0400)
Signed-off-by: Adam C. Emerson <aemerson@redhat.com>
src/messages/MAuthReply.h

index be3368e653375b1592c7914430c1d2d8457cba2a..ec47ff2001c47e41f122e1ff52c21dfa35d5b7d7 100644 (file)
@@ -25,11 +25,11 @@ public:
   __u32 protocol;
   errorcode32_t result;
   uint64_t global_id;      // if zero, meaningless
-  string result_msg;
-  bufferlist result_bl;
+  std::string result_msg;
+  ceph::buffer::list result_bl;
 
   MAuthReply() : MessageInstance(CEPH_MSG_AUTH_REPLY), protocol(0), result(0), global_id(0) {}
-  MAuthReply(__u32 p, bufferlist *bl = NULL, int r = 0, uint64_t gid=0, const char *msg = "") :
+  MAuthReply(__u32 p, ceph::buffer::list *bl = NULL, int r = 0, uint64_t gid=0, const char *msg = "") :
     MessageInstance(CEPH_MSG_AUTH_REPLY),
     protocol(p), result(r), global_id(gid),
     result_msg(msg) {
@@ -41,7 +41,7 @@ private:
 
 public:
   std::string_view get_type_name() const override { return "auth_reply"; }
-  void print(ostream& o) const override {
+  void print(std::ostream& o) const override {
     o << "auth_reply(proto " << protocol << " " << result << " " << cpp_strerror(result);
     if (result_msg.length())
       o << ": " << result_msg;
@@ -49,6 +49,7 @@ public:
   }
 
   void decode_payload() override {
+    using ceph::decode;
     auto p = payload.cbegin();
     decode(protocol, p);
     decode(result, p);